**Handover note — shuttle-bus gate**

Hey Tomas, welcome aboard! Quick one from me before I head off: the shuttle between Fennick Yard and the main campus runs every 20 minutes, and the gate by Bay C is the pickup spot. The barrier won't open with your badge until HR activates it (takes a few days), so until then just punch in the gate code. It's this:

turnstile pass: bdg-QZV-3

Memo: FY Headcount Plan — Morvath Holdings

To the board. Next year's plan caps total headcount at a 4% increase. Engineering at Dunlace gets the bulk; corporate functions stay flat. Contractor spend drops 15%. Hiring freezes lift in Q2, pending revenue targets. Final numbers go to committee Thursday. Strategic rationale is set out below.

confidential, bahof-yaweg: Headcount on the Kaseth team goes from 32 to 109 by the end of January. Gross margin on Kaseth came in at 46 percent against a plan of 45 percent.

Alert: TilePorter prefetcher backlog high. Fires when the queue of pending map-tile prefetch jobs exceeds 50k for ten minutes. Usual causes: a stale region manifest or the Harrowgate render cluster running degraded. Check cluster health first, then requeue the oldest region batch. Safe to silence during scheduled basemap refreshes. If the backlog keeps growing after a requeue, contact the tiles on-call.

escalation mailbox, bafog-fafog: ulador@paliqlabs.internal